The Sales Coordinator is responsible for managing the proposal process for all new business proposals in Loopio, as well as ensuring process timelines are met and coordinating administrative functions in support of the sales process. She will support the development, writing, formatting and editing of proposals, responses, presentations and other documents as needed. She will prepare, rewrite, edit or proof documents to detect and correct errors in spelling, punctuation and syntax, as well as reviewing consistency and compliance with requirements. She will also participate in establishing proposal schedules and support the proposal work plan, managing assignments and collecting and organizing proposal content. She will create, update and enhance the quality of proposal content. She will maintain accuracy of Salesforce records and new business scorecard.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
- Be a role model for the company culture.
- Develop proposal schedule, outline and other materials needed for proposal process.
- Manage and enforce proposal schedules to meet multiple, and often overlapping, deadlines
- Assist in scheduling prospect calls and gathering questions from department heads and sales team.
- Conduct and participate in meetings with internal resources and prospects to create winning proposals
- Format and layout of proposal documents; to include integrating text and graphics in Loopio and convert inputs from multiple sources (Department Heads and Sales team) in to one cohesive proposal
- Write and edit clear, concise and compelling proposal content
- Assign writing and editing responsibilities; write and / or rewrite proposal content derived from internal resources or subject matter experts through one-on-one interviews or prepared text
- Create the final proposal document, both electronic (PDF) and hard copy (if required) versions
- Ensure that the Loopio proposal content library and the AH New Business folder is organized and up-to-date
- Assist in developing proposal presentations as necessary and coordinate presentation logistical arrangements
- Manage inventory of sales collateral. Prepare and ship, as needed, presentation packets and tradeshow exhibit materials
- Maintain Salesforce records and dashboard, as well as the NB scorecard in Google Drive
- Coordinate logistical arrangements of new client deep dive meetings and "get to know" sessions
